Exactly What is Royalty-Free Music?

Royalty-free music is a kind of music licensing that permits developers to utilize a track numerous times without paying additional costs. As soon as you've acquired the license, you can use the music in multiple tasks, without recurring royalties or payments. Nevertheless, it's important to comprehend that "royalty-free" doesn't constantly equate to "free." Some royalty-free tracks require an in advance payment, while others are entirely free for both personal and commercial use.

The crucial benefit of royalty-free music is its flexibility. Unlike conventional certified music, which requires payment each time a track is used, royalty-free music permits creators to pay once-- or not at all-- and utilize the track throughout a wide range of platforms and content types.

The Growing Need for No Copyright Music

In the digital age, platforms like YouTube, Instagram, and TikTok have strict copyright policies, mostly created to safeguard the rights of original content developers. Nevertheless, this frequently leaves video creators susceptible to having their content flagged or even gotten rid of if they inadvertently use copyrighted music. YouTube, for instance, uses a sophisticated Content ID system that can instantly find copyrighted product and limit or generate income from content accordingly. For creators depending on these platforms for earnings, copyright strikes can lead to demonetization, which means no advertisement revenue from their videos.

This is where no copyright music is available in as a service. Copyright-free or royalty-free tracks allow developers to use music in their jobs without facing copyright claims. These tracks are clearly licensed for public usage and generally readily available in audio libraries across the web. Utilizing copyright-free background music allows content creators to legally include audio into their work, giving them comfort that they won't encounter legal difficulty.

Where to Find the Best No Copyright Music

There are several platforms that provide extensive libraries of royalty-free music. Some of the most popular sources consist of:

Pixabay is known for its vast collection of free stock music. With over 30,000 music tracks readily available for download, the platform offers music across a vast array of categories and state of minds, from relaxing ambient music to high-energy electronic tracks. Pixabay is specifically appealing to YouTube developers due to the fact that the music is free for commercial usage and does not require attribution.

Bensound is another popular option for developers trying to find premium royalty-free music. It offers a series of genres, from cinematic and orchestral pieces to upbeat, business background music. While Bensound does need attribution for free tracks, developers can likewise purchase licenses for more substantial use without requiring to credit the artist.

FiftySounds is a growing platform that provides exclusive royalty-free tracks, upgraded regularly to guarantee fresh material. FiftySounds is perfect for creators looking for unique, high-quality music for both individual and business use. Free downloads are offered with attribution, however the platform likewise offers a paid version for developers who choose to skip crediting the source.

Best Practices When Using Royalty-Free Music

When utilizing royalty-free music, it's essential to guarantee that you're abiding by the licensing agreements associated with the tracks. While royalty-free music is devoid of continuous payments, some tracks might require attribution to the artist or composer. Always check the regards to the license and provide proper credit when necessary.
